Bug Description
I'm using Kubuntu Intrepid for over a month. Today, I decided to install the ubuntu-desktop metapackage so that I can see what's going on with the Ubuntu development.
When I chose GNOME as my session to use Ubuntu, both Knetworkmanager and Gnome's network manager started up. This should not be, only Gnome's Network Manager should load when using Ubuntu.
While browsing the sessions applet, I noticed that both jockey-kde and jockey-gtk were set to start up with Gnome. This also should not be.
Before Intrepid, I've been using Kubuntu+Ubuntu at the same time without this problem.
Update: Same behaviour when logging into KDE, both Knetworkmanager and Network Manager load.
